Souvik Das

Software Engineer

Mumbai, Maharashtra, India3 yrs 3 mos experience
Highly Stable

Key Highlights

  • Expert in building scalable backend systems for fintech.
  • Proven track record in optimizing financial transaction processes.
  • Strong experience in event-driven microservices architecture.
Stackforce AI infers this person is a Fintech Backend Developer with expertise in high-volume transaction systems.

Contact

Skills

Core Skills

JavaMicroservices

Other Skills

KafkaPostgreSQLRedisLinuxAPIForex rate bookingReal-time monitoringAlerting dashboardsCore JavaMySQLObject-Oriented Programming (OOP)DockerSpring CloudSpring SecuritySpring Framework

About

I build backend systems that move money across borders — reliably, securely, and at scale. As a Java Backend Developer at NPCI for 3+ years, I've contributed to international UPI and RuPay settlement infrastructure, working on reconciliation workflows, multi-currency processing, and event-driven distributed pipelines using Java, Spring Boot, Kafka, PostgreSQL, and Redis. I enjoy solving hard backend problems — whether it's optimizing a slow query, debugging a production incident at 2 am, or designing a system that needs to handle thousands of transactions without missing a beat.

Experience

3 yrs 3 mos
Total Experience
3 yrs 2 mos
Average Tenure
1 mo
Current Experience

Mobikwik

Software Development Engineer 2

Apr 2026Present · 1 mo · Gurugram · On-site

National payments corporation of india (npci)

3 roles

Senior Associate - Application Development

Promoted

Dec 2024Apr 2026 · 1 yr 4 mos · Mumbai · On-site

  • Developed Kafka-based event-driven microservices for high-volume financial message processing (JSON/XML), ensuring reliability and data integrity.
  • Optimized PostgreSQL queries and Redis caching, reducing reconciliation processing time by 50% and improving system throughput.
  • Worked closely with cross-functional teams across UAT, testing, and production support, resolving critical issues via root-cause analysis.
  • Handled production readiness (DR drills, server setup, deployments), ensuring high availability and minimal downtime.
KafkaPostgreSQLRedisLinuxJavaMicroservices

Associate - Application Development

Promoted

Dec 2023Nov 2024 · 11 mos · Mumbai · On-site

  • Contributed to backend development enabling onboarding of 2 countries to international UPI, increasing cross-border transactions by 30%.
  • Built API-driven forex rate booking workflows integrated with partner banks for multi-currency settlements.
  • Developed real-time monitoring & alerting dashboards, thus minimizing manual intervention.
  • Led production incident handling, improving system stability through proactive fixes and RCA.
APIForex rate bookingReal-time monitoringAlerting dashboardsJavaMicroservices

Graduate Engineer Trainee

Dec 2022Nov 2023 · 11 mos · Mumbai · On-site

  • Managed production server configurations for the iUPI system, ensuring reliable functioning.
  • Executed day-to-day operational tasks, ensuring smooth functioning within the settlement framework.
  • Oversaw deployment and operations of critical services in the system, collaborating with teams for smooth execution.
Core JavaMySQLJava

Education

International Institute of Information Technology Hyderabad (IIITH)

PGCert — Advanced Full Stack Development

May 2023Apr 2024

Dr. B.C. Roy Engineering College

Bachelor of Technology - BTech — Electrical Engineering

Aug 2018Jul 2022

Jawahar Vidya Mandir, Ranchi

AISSCE — Science

Apr 2015Mar 2017

St. Xavier's School, Sahibganj

ICSE — Science

Jan 2014Mar 2015

Stackforce found 100+ more professionals with Java & Microservices

Explore similar profiles based on matching skills and experience

Souvik Das - Software Engineer | Stackforce